If you pursue a degree in electrical engineering, you won't be alone. The field of study is the #39 most popular program in the country. So, there are lots of possibilities to explore when you're trying to determine where you want to get your degree.

For its 2024 ranking, College Factual looked at 12 schools in Massachusetts to determine which ones were the best for electrical engineering students pursuing a degree. When you put them all together, these colleges and universities awarded 1,254 degrees in electrical engineering during the 2020-2021 academic year.

Massachusetts Institute of Technology is one of the best schools in the country for getting a degree in electrical engineering. MIT is a large private not-for-profit school located in the medium-sized city of Cambridge. A Best Colleges rank of #1 out of 2,217 colleges nationwide means MIT is a great school overall.

There were roughly 173 electrical engineering students who graduated with this degree at MIT in the most recent year we have data available. Degree recipients from the electrical engineering degree program at Massachusetts Institute of Technology get $40,611 more than the average college graduate with the same degree when they enter the workforce.

Worcester Polytechnic Institute is a wonderful option for students pursuing a degree in electrical engineering. Located in the city of Worcester, WPI is a private not-for-profit school with a medium-sized student population. A Best Colleges rank of #53 out of 2,217 schools nationwide means WPI is a great school overall.

There were about 177 electrical engineering students who graduated with this degree at WPI in the most recent data year. Graduates who receive their degree from the ee program make an average of $85,910 in their early career salary.
